Using RShiny as a supplement to DHIS2 for Advanced Data Analytics

This application uses Shiny as an R package to enhance the analytical capability of the DHIS2 platform by providing more explorative and comparative analytics. The application provides more granular insights, making complex data approachable through various visuals and pivot tables. It supports offline analysis, geographical insights, custom calculations, and data integrity checks, offering a comprehensive tool for in-depth analysis and trend monitoring over time.

The process involves collecting data from multiple sources, performing backend calculations, and visualizing data using the RShiny app. Despite the challenges of handling large datasets and complex calculations, especially for larger countries, the implementation of efficient caching mechanisms is highlighted as crucial for smooth data loading and presentation. This tool aims to provide a single location for easy data analysis and comprehensive reporting.
